Mary Ann Hogg, 88 of Pine Mountain, Georgia died Sunday, August 19, 2019 at Pruitt Health of Greenville, Georgia.

Mrs. Hogg was born September 13, 1930 in Pine Mountain, Georgia, formerly Chipley, the daughter of Jesse and Thelma Irvin McGee. Mrs. Hogg retired from serving as the switch-board operator at Callaway Gardens. She devoted her time primarily serving in church as a Sunday school teacher and secretarial duties over the years at Bethany Baptist, Bethlehem Baptist and New Covenant Baptist Churches. She enjoyed her pet Yorkshire terriers, Duke and J.R. and spoiled them as much as her own grandchildren.

She is preceded in death by her parents, Jesse and Thelma Irvin McGee; her siblings Meuzette Johnson, Betty Jean Shumate, Jesse McGee Jr., and Peggy McGee; her husband William Allen Hogg; and her daughter Frances Diane Kelly.
